I like Nokia 5700 XpressMusic.
This was the phone Nokia I purchased since the 3210. It was quite difficult to find, as most shops were not aware of the phone & this includes the likes of Carphone Warehouse & that awful retailer in most high street's called Phones4U.
Music player is good, great sound even from the standard earphones that come with the phone - even better with the music
headphones from Nokia. I find one problem with the music player, the buttons are too slow & it normally takes a second or two to react when wanting to pause a file. It is even worse when trying to stop a file; it normally starts to play the track again.
Video option, tried transferring some music video files, does not work at all. Camera is okay, although the flash is very bright. Good features & there are different camera types as well. Usability is great, although it takes a few days to get used too & you find lots of shortcuts & features. Very user-friendly.
I really liked this phone, saved having to carrying an
iPod & a phone, especially on the morning journeys to work while using the tubes to get to work. However, the phone has been hassle. Within three weeks, there was a problem with the mic & people would not hear me. I thought it was an issue with diverting all calls - made sure that there were no diversions & it worked. Within in a week, the same problem & took it to the local Nokia repair centre; they replaced the mic & the phone worked. I called someone the next day, they could not hear me. The phone is now been sent to Nokia & I am not sure what will happen. Only had the phone for 6 weeks & used it for less than 4.
Conclusion: Good phone, if your one works. Wish I got the N73 music edition instead.
